Marcus Hinojoz

The brisket was incredibly flavorful. It was juicy and tender as hell. The ribs were fall off the bone and had great flavor even on their own. When paired with their BBQ sauce, which has a unique peppery, smoky, vinegar-forward taste, it cut through the richness of the brisket perfectly and added another layer of flavor.

The mac and cheese was really good. You can tell butter is used, and the cheeses were flavorful and well balanced. The chipotle beans were decent overall, but I felt neutral about them.

Shoutout to Mike for being awesome. I didn’t check the closing time and he was already cleaning up, but he called me while I was right around the corner and still took care of me.

I will absolutely be back to try more of their menu.

Harold Wofford

Let me say, brisket is great. I am from Texas, and this is the best brisket I have had in California. Great smoke ring, fat crusted and melted in my mouth, burnt ends were great too. The sides are generous sizes, and we paid $35 a person. Which was worth every penny. Could not find anything wrong. There is plenty of seating outside, not much on inside.

Wheelchair accessibility: You can easily maneuver a wheelchair
